What does a digital producer do?

A digital producer is responsible for monitoring the development of digital content campaigns from initial planning to distribution and publishing. Digital producers supervise the creation of designs, ensuring that the plans stay within the clients' specifications and budget requirements. They also analyze the scope and limitations of the contents, maintaining its focus on the target audience. A digital producer reviews the current digital trends to identify strategic techniques, promoting client's brands, and attract potential clients to generate more revenues and increase profitability.

What does a certified medical technician do?

Certified Medical Technicians are specialists in medical diagnoses by performing laboratory testing and analysis for hospitals and physicians. Their duties include lab sanitization to prepare for testing and collection, recording medical samples for testing, specimen preparation, blood drawing for donation and testing, and assisting physicians with sample collection as well as equipment handling in surgical rooms. They must also understand how to use complex and sensitive testing equipment such as cell counters, analyzers, microscopes, and centrifuges.
